Quick KNTU update for those not listening.


- They now have an HD transmitter

- The music mix and variety has improved over the last couple months

- 88.1 HD 2 now plays the jazz music that used to be played on 88.1 (no longer solely streamed)

- Still commercial free

- Still haven’t brought athletics back
